Origins
Casino slots are among the most popular games played in the world. They're simple to play and provide a variety of themes, features, and payouts. The themes include Greek, Roman, Egyptian and Fantasy. A lot of machines also provide progressive jackpots and free spins. These games are equipped with touch-screen technology which let players interact with them without using the mouse or keyboard.
The history of slot machines began in 1887 when Sittman and Pitt designed machines that utilized five different drums to display poker hands. The machine didn't actually pay out cash, and instead offered prizes like drinks at New York bars. A later machine created by Charles Fey allowed for automatic payouts and substituted the poker symbols with diamonds spades, horseshoes hearts, and liberty bells, which gave it its infamous name. This invention set the stage for modern online slots and brick-and-mortar casinos.

Symbols
In addition to the standard pay symbols that reward players for matching certain combinations of icons, some slots also feature special symbols known as "wild" or multiplier symbols. These symbols can be combined to form winning combinations that otherwise would not exist, and they can also increase a winning line's payout. These symbols are typically located on the lower reels, and are often identified with an arrow or a special icon to indicate their purpose.
The symbols of slot machines can differ from game to game and can be customized to suit the theme. Some of the most common symbols are the card suits of three suits - diamonds, hearts and spades - as well as traditional lucky symbols such as horseshoes. Slot games use a variety of symbols to create an atmosphere and feel that is unique. Some of these symbols are stacked, meaning they appear on multiple reels and are grouped together to create a bigger payout than single symbols.
They include a range of different fruit symbols like plums, cherries, watermelons and oranges. They are reputed to trigger jackpots and other major payouts, particularly when stacked on a reel. They also provide excellent bonus symbols and their vibrant colors are sure to attract the attention of players of all kinds.
Another popular symbol is the bar, which can be found in all kinds of slot machines. These rectangular shapes have been in use since the beginning of slot machines and may come in different forms, such as single or double bars. They are considered lucky in many cultures, and have an almost universal appeal.
Other slot symbols include wild, scatter and multiplier symbols, which can be used to activate various bonus events. They can range from free spins to second-screen bonus games. These symbols are less popular than the more traditional ones.
